Regarding Card My Yard's financial statements, what is the potential impact of management's estimates and assumptions on the reported amounts?
Card_My_Yard Franchise · 2025 FDDAnswer from 2025 FDD Document
The preparation of the Company's financial statements in conformity with U.S. GAAP requires management to make estimates and assumptions that affect the reported amounts of assets and liabilities, and disclosures. Accordingly, actual results could differ from those estimates.

What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to the 2025 FDD, Card My Yard's financial statements are prepared following U.S.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P). A critical aspect of GAAP is that it requires the company's management to make estimates and assumptions that can influence the reported values of assets, liabilities, and related disclosures. This means that the financial statements presented are not purely factual but incorporate judgments made by Card My Yard's management.
The FDD highlights that actual results for Card My Yard could potentially differ from these initial estimates. This discrepancy arises because estimates are inherently based on current information and expectations about future events, which may not always materialize as predicted. For example, assumptions about future revenue growth, the lifespan of assets, or the collectibility of receivables can all impact the financial figures reported.
For a prospective Card My Yard franchisee, this disclosure is a reminder to exercise caution when reviewing the financial statements. It's important to understand that the numbers presented are based on management's best judgment at a specific point in time and are subject to change. A potential franchisee should consider the reasonableness of these estimates, perhaps by comparing them to industry benchmarks or seeking advice from a financial professional. Furthermore, understanding the key assumptions underlying the financial statements can provide valuable insight into the potential risks and opportunities associated with investing in a Card My Yard franchise.
